Abstract:
OBJECTIVE To study the protective effect of ginkgolide K on cerebral ischemia.
METHODS Anoxia was produced by close normobaric hypoxia; the survival time of mice was determined; acute incomplete cerebral ischemia was induced by ligaturing bilateral carotid arterise; breath time, brain lactic acid content and alkaline phosphatase activities, brain index and brain water content were detected, morphologic change was observed.
RESULTS Ginkgolide K prolonged the survival time of hypoxic-ischemic mice in dose-dependent manner. In acute incomplete cerebral ischemia mice, ginkgolide K extended breathing time, reduced lactic acid content, decreased alkaline phosphatase activity, lessened brain index and brain water content. Moreover, pathological examination showed that ginkgolide K ameliorated the cerebral ischemia-reperfusion injury in mice nerve cells and reduced tissue necrosis.
CONCLUSION Ginkgolide K has a protective effect on ischemia brain damage.
